Breakfast Sausage Cake

"This is a wonderful breakfast cake that includes sausage. It's wonderful spices fill the air as you bake it making your house smell as good as it tastes! It's an 'in a hurry, out the door' morning food that you don't even mind giving the kids."

Prep Time:
30 Min
Cook Time:
1 Hr 30 Min
Ready In:
2 Hrs

Servings  (Help)

Calculate

 

Original Recipe Yield 12 servings
 

Ingredients

  • 1 cup raisins
  • 3 cups boiling water
  • 1 pound ground pork sausage
  • 1 1/2 cups white sugar
  • 1 1/2 cups brown sugar
  • 2 eggs, lightly beaten
  • 3 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on ground ginger
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1 teaspoon pumpkin pie spice
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1 cup cold coffee
  • 1 cup chopped walnuts

Directions

  1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Place raisins in a bowl and cover with boiling water; set aside for 5 to 10 minutes. Drain well and dry raisins in cloth, set aside.
  2. Place sausage in a large, deep skillet. Cook over medium-high heat until lightly brown. Drain, crumble into small pieces and set aside.
  3. In a large bowl, combine sausage, white sugar and brown sugar; stir until mixture is well blended. Add eggs and beat well.
  4. In a separate bowl, sift together flour, ginger, baking powder and pumpkin pie spice. Stir baking soda into coffee. Add flour mixture and coffee alternately to meat mixture, beating well after each addition. Fold raisins and walnuts into cake batter. Turn batter into well-greased and floured Bundt cake pan.
  5. Bake in preheated oven for 75 to 90 minutes until done. Cool 15 minutes in pan before turning out onto serving platter.
